estar encantado

An intransitive verb phrase is a phrase that combines a verb with a preposition or other particle and does not require a direct object (e.g., Everybody please stand up.).
intransitive verb phrase
a. to be delighted
Estuve encantado de tenerles a ustedes aquí. Espero que vuelvan pronto.I was delighted to have you here. I hope you'll come back soon.
a. to be enchanted
Dicen que este castillo está encantado, y que por las noches seres maravillosos recorren sus pasillos y estancias.They say that this castle is enchanted, and that marvellous beings move around its corridors and rooms at night.
b. to be bewitched
¿El príncipe está encantado? - Sí, una bruja lo ha convertido en sapo.Is the prince bewitched? - Yes, a witch has turned him into a toad.
